History of Mobile Gaming

Mobile gaming began in the late 1990s with simple games on early mobile phones. These games were often basic and limited in functionality . They laid the groundwork for future developments. It’s fascinating how far we’ve come. The introduction of smartphones revolutionized the industry. Suddenly, complex games became accessible to a wider audience. This shift changed gaming habits significantly. Many people now prefer mobile gaming over traditional consoles. Isn’t that interesting? The convenience of gaming on-the-go is appealing.     Tools and Technologies for Mobile Game Development

    Mobile game development relies on various tools and technologies. He emphasizes the importance of game engines like Unity and Unreal Engine. These platforms streamline the development process significantly. Additionally, programming languages such as C# and Java are commonly used. They provide flexibility and efficiency in coding.

    Key tools include:

  • Unity: Popular gor 2D and 3D games.
  • Unreal Engine: Known for high-quality graphics.
  • C#: Widely used for scripting in Unity.

    Advertising Models in Mobile Games

    Advertising models in mobile games are essential for monetization. He explains that these models provide developers with significant revenue opportunities. Common formats include banner ads, interstitial ads, and rewarded video ads. Each format has unique advantages and can enhance user experience.

    Key benefits include:

  • Increased visibility: Ads reach a broad audience.
  • User engagement: Rewarded ads incentivize participation.
  • Cost-effectiveness: Lower acquisition costs for developers.

    Major Mobile E-Sports Tournaments

    Major mobile e-sports tournaments have gained significant attention globally. He highlights events like the PUBG Mobile Global Championship and the Free Fire World Series. These tournaments attract top players and large audiences, enhancing their visibility. Additionally, substantial prize pools incentivize participation and competition.

    Key aspects include:

  • Sponsorship deals: Increase financial backijg.
  • Live streaming: Expands audience reach.
  • Community involvement: Engages fans actively.
